Compliance Committee

 

General Purpose of Compliance Committee:

Working in conjunction with members throughout the association, research and discuss current and proposed federal and state regulatory guidelines, their impact on members, and communicate to the Education and Legislative committees as well as the IMBA general membership as needed.

 

Members:

Members of this committee will include a Chair (current 1MBA member with responsibilities and/or experience in the compliance area) and members of the association representing compliance and various other areas of residential lending, including vendors.

General Responsibilities and Expectations:

  • Compliance Committee Chair to work pro-actively with IMBA ED to recruit committee members, set up a schedule of meetings/calls, and, either in person, via call, or written report, provide details of activities as warranted
  • Determine a date each summer to have a meeting/call to begin the process of developing the needs and a calendar for the upcoming year, starting in September
  • Working with ED, regularly send communication out to membership concerning meetings, upcoming training/education and request feedback on additional topics of interest/need
  • Working with the Education Committee Chair, schedule meetings, webinars, etc. to educate members on compliance issues, utilizing existing members or outside experts to present the subject material
  • Working with Legislative Committee Chair, provide input and feedback on federal and state compliance issues to be discussed with the Legislative Committee to formulate positions and input to appropriate state and federal regulators and legislators
  • Whenever possible, work with the Education Committee and the NMLS to provide continuing education (CE) credit on training/courses offered
    When calendar items are set, work with ED to have posted on IMBA web site

Goals:

Provide opportunities for committee members to discuss various compliance issues
and their impact on business, and to share with IMBA membership via e-mail, web
site updates and training/education opportunities
